Map sheet number OL26 in the OS Explorer series covers the Cleveland Hills, the western area of the North York Moors and a small section of the Howardian Hills. Highlights of the area include: Saltburn-by-the-Sea, Guisborough, Helmsley, and Roseberry Topping.
